Provider Overview
Strengths & Best For
CUDO Compute provides managed H100 and A100 GPU clusters powered by green energy, combining enterprise SLAs with a sustainability-first mission for large-scale AI training and LLM workloads. On-demand and reserved billing options are available across EU and US regions, with EU data residency for GDPR-compliant workloads. A strong choice for enterprises that need both high-performance GPU infrastructure and verifiable green compute credentials.
- Green energy focus
- Managed clusters
- Enterprise SLAs
- EU data residency
Bentaus offers high-performance H100 and A100 GPU cloud instances for AI training and inference workloads with competitive on-demand and spot pricing, making it accessible for research teams and startups that need flagship NVIDIA hardware without enterprise contracts. Fast provisioning and straightforward billing lower the barrier to entry for LLM fine-tuning and model deployment. A practical on-demand GPU cloud for teams that prioritize hardware performance and cost efficiency.
- Competitive pricing
- High-performance hardware
- Fast provisioning

Support tiers and region coverage
CUDO Compute offers Standard → Enterprise support across 3 regions (EU-West, US-East, APAC). Bentaus offers Standard support across 1 region (US). CUDO Compute's broader region footprint gives it an advantage for latency-sensitive workloads or teams with data residency requirements in specific geographies.
Provider background: CUDO Compute vs Bentaus
CUDO Compute was founded in 2021 and is headquartered in London, UK. Bentaus was founded in 2023 and is headquartered in United States. CUDO Compute has 2 years more operational history than Bentaus, which may matter for teams evaluating provider stability and long-term contract risk.
